Hydrogen Absorption Lines in the Cosmic Microwave Background Spectrum
Abstract
We have calculated the intensities of the subordinate hydrogen lines formed during the recombination epoch at redshifts 800 < z < 1600. We show that an allowance for the angular momentum splitting of hydrogen atomic energy levels and the dipole transition selection rules can reveal absorption features in the cosmic microwave background recombination spectrum in the submillimeter wavelength range.
